Common Causes of Water Damage in a Bathroom
The washroom is incredibly prone for moist build-up and also possible water damage because of the constant use of water in it. This short article provides straightforward examination techniques to assist identifying water damages hazards.
The frequent use water in the washroom makes it extremely susceptible for damp build-up and also potential water damage. By examining it on a regular basis, you can minimize water relevant problems.
The following set of inspections is simple to do and also need to be done as soon as in every three months in order to keep your shower room healthy and also to stop possible water damages brought on by the bath tub, the shower, pipeline joints and also plumbing, sinks, cupboards, as well as the bathroom
Do not overlook performing these inspections and also be detailed while executing them. Remember that these simple inspections can conserve you a great deal of money by providing early indicators for water damages

Tub and also Shower


The shower as well as bathtub call for special focus as well as maintenance. Inspect the tiles as well as replace if cracked. See to it that there is no missing out on grout between the floor tiles. Evaluate as well as replace fractured caulking at joints where the walls meet the flooring or the bathtub. Obstructed drains pipes and pipelines problems will certainly avoid the bath tub from drying and also may suggest major problems underneath the bathtub. Talk to an expert quickly to avoid structural damage. Pay attention to discolorations or soft areas around the bath tub walls as they might indicate an inner leak.

Plumbing


Signs for water damage are difficult to detect given that many pipes are set up inside the wall surfaces.
Pay special focus to flooring as well as wall surfaces wetness and spots as they might indicate an unseen plumbing problem. Inspect dampness degrees in adjacent areas also.

Sinks as well as Cabinets


Sinks and also closets are exposed to wetness and also humidity day-to-day and are often ignored. Evaluate frequently under the sink and also on the countertop above it. Fix any kind of drip in the catch as it may recommend drainpipe problems. Check out the sink, slow-moving draining pipes may show a blocked drain. Change sink seals if they are broken or loose.

The Commode


The commode is a susceptible water joint. Examine the water lines and also search for leaks around the bathroom seat, in the hose, as well as under the water storage tank. If you spot any type of indications of dampness on the floor around the toilet, check for leakages in the toilet rim as well as storage tank seals.
Be aware that hanging toilet bowl antiperspirants increases the chances for clogs.

Water Damage Signs In The Bathroom To Avoid Cleanup


Musty smell


This is one of the easiest signs to catch because musty smells are so odorous. The damp, earthy, moldy smell should be a big red flag. The smell will develop when moisture gets trapped in surfaces, and begins to facilitate mold growth. Leaking pipes under cabinets, inside walls, and behind shower fixtures will cause moisture to stay trapped and not dry, which will lead to mold growth and spread. As soon as you notice any musty smells in your bathroom, have it checked for hidden water damage and cleanup signs.


Visible mold


If the smell isn’t there to give it away, sometimes you will actually see mold growth. Finding mold in your bathroom is a serious problem, because mold is very harmful to your health. By the time mold growth is visible, it also means that water damage has already occurred and been present for some time. The only way the mold problem can be resolved is to find the source of the moisture and get it stopped. To safely and adequately remove mold, you need to have professionals handle the remediation. Do not waste any time in getting mold problems addressed, fixed, and sanitized so that you can protect you and your family from the many respiratory symptoms caused by mold exposure.


Damaged floors



Bathroom floors should be able to withstand some exposure to water while still remaining in good condition. However, when excess exposure or water leaks occur, they will begin to damage even the most water-resistant flooring. If you notice any cracking, bubbling, staining, or warping on your bathroom floors, there is probably a water leak somewhere causing the distortion. If you notice areas of the floor have become softer, or even have a spongy feeling, there is probably damage to the subfloor. Subflooring is typically made up of plywood. When plywood is exposed to water or moisture, it will absorb it. Once it has become saturated, the weight of the excess water will cause the wood to swell and soften. Check the floors in your bathroom frequently to catch any of these sings before they lead to damaged subflooring.


Changes on walls


When water leaks behind walls, it will cause changes in the drywall. Peeling plaster, blistering paint, and soggy wallpaper are all good indicators that excess water is building up behind the wall. Water leaking behind drywall will cause it to swell and be soft to the tough. If you start to notice gaps along the trim of your walls, or where tile meets the wall, it could also be a strong indicator that there is a leak behind the wall. Any changes, distortion, or damage on the walls should be evaluated as soon as you notice it to prevent further water damage and cleanup.
